Purple Millet and Iceland Poppy Physical Information

Purple Millet and Iceland Poppy physical information is very important for comparison. Purple Millet height is 90.00 cm and width 30.50 cm whereas Iceland Poppy height is Not Available and width Not Available. The color specification of Purple Millet and Iceland Poppy are as follows:

  • Purple Millet flower color: Brown, Purple and Purplish-black

  • Purple Millet leaf color: Purple, Dark Green and Burgundy

  • Iceland Poppy flower color: White, Yellow, Red, Orange, Pink and Coral

  • Iceland Poppy leaf color: Blue Green and Gray Green
